Does Minimum Tillage Improve Smallholder Farmers’ Welfare? Evidence from Southern Tanzania

Peer-reviewed publication
Diciembre, 2020
Tanzania

Conservation agriculture continues to be promoted in developing nations as a sustainable and suitable agricultural practice to enhance smallholder productivity. A look at the literature indicates that this practice is successful in non-African countries. Thus, this research sought to test whether minimum tillage (MT), a subset of conservation agriculture, could lead to a significant impact on smallholder households’ welfare in Southern Tanzania.

Nationwide Susceptibility Mapping of Landslides in Kenya Using the Fuzzy Analytic Hierarchy Process Model

Peer-reviewed publication
Diciembre, 2020
Kenya

Landslide susceptibility mapping (LSM) is a cost-effective tool for landslide hazard mitigation. To date, no nationwide landslide susceptibility maps have been produced for the entire Kenyan territory. Hence, this work aimed to develop a landslide susceptibility map at the national level in Kenya using the fuzzy analytic hierarchy process method. First, a hierarchical evaluation index system containing 10 landslide contributing factors and their subclasses was established to produce a susceptibility map.

Effect of Complex Road Networks on Intensive Land Use in China’s Beijing-Tianjin-Hebei Urban Agglomeration

Peer-reviewed publication
Diciembre, 2020
China
Rusia
Estados Unidos de América

Coupled with rapid urbanization and urban expansion, the spatial relationship between transportation development and land use has gained growing interest among researchers and policy makers. In this paper, a complex network model and land use intensity assessment were integrated into a spatial econometric model to explore the spatial spillover effect of the road network on intensive land use patterns in China’s Beijing–Tianjin–Hebei (BTH) urban agglomeration.

Exploring the Dynamics of Urban Greenness Space and Their Driving Factors Using Geographically Weighted Regression: A Case Study in Wuhan Metropolis, China

Peer-reviewed publication
Diciembre, 2020
China
Russia
United States of America

Urban greenness plays a vital role in supporting the ecosystem services of a city. Exploring the dynamics of urban greenness space and their driving forces can provide valuable information for making solid urban planning policies. This study aims to investigate the dynamics of urban greenness space patterns through landscape indices and to apply geographically weighted regression (GWR) to map the spatially varied impact on the indices from economic and environmental factors.

Renewables—To Build or Not? Czech Approach to Impact Assessment of Renewable Energy Sources with an Emphasis on Municipality Perspective

Peer-reviewed publication
Diciembre, 2020
Global

The process of decarbonization and increasing the share of renewable sources of energy (RES) arising not only from European Union targets leads to development, expansion, and construction of new RES. Municipalities thus face a decision whether to support/accept RES projects or not. Although energy managers are part of the municipality management in almost all bigger cities, mayors of smaller municipalities have to go through the decision-making process on their own.
